This one looks a lot cleaner. According to the log, the scheduler makes a connection and it clearly appears in the trace, then the agent refuses the connection with error code -2048. To the best of my knowledge that error is returned when there is some problem with a license, for example, an invalid or missing license key. This also could be also an issue with different versions, version v4.x against v3.x having incompatible license keys.

I just confirmed that v4.1 scheduler will not be able to connect to v3.4 agent because of their license incompatibility. You would need to deploy 4.1 or 4.0 agent MP Edition on a Windows system in order to have your Linux scheduler connect to and run tasks on that Windows system.

Did you uncheck "Remote agent is 24x7 Scheduler/agent for Windows" option in the remote agent connection properties?
PS. This option is to indicate type of the agent software, not type of the remote operation system.
